Problem with pg_dump and decimal mark

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



Hello,

I have done a backup of a postgres database on a virtual machine (Windows 8.1) using pg_dump.

On another (non-virtual) machine the restore (with psql) worked without problems.

On the third virtual machine, however, the restore fails.

(ERROR: invalid input syntax for type double precision: 0.100000000001)

When I change the value in the sql file manually to 0,100000000001 the and try again, the restore resumes until the next double value.

How is this possible? Does psql really expect comma-seperated decimal values in the sql file? How can I change this behaviour?
